3D地球数据可视化组件
globe.gl 是一个基于 Three.js 的开源 3D 地球数据可视化组件,由开源社区维护,专门用于在 Web 端快速构建交互式 3D 地球模型,并叠加点、弧线、热力图等数据图层。它之所以被开发者选中,是因为它提供了开箱即用的地球渲染能力,无需从零搭建 WebGL 场景,且完全免费、无商业授权限制,适合需要在地理空间上展示数据的项目。
globe.gl 本质上是一个开源 JavaScript 库,并非商业公司提供的付费服务。它由社区开发者维护,核心代码托管在 GitHub 上,遵循 MIT 许可证。该项目脱胎于 Three.js 生态,专门针对 3D 地球可视化场景进行了优化,提供了地球纹理、大气效果、经纬度坐标映射等基础功能。在行业地位上,globe.gl 属于轻量级地理可视化工具,与 Cesium、Mapbox GL 等大型引擎相比,它更专注于“地球球体+数据标记”这一细分领域。客户类型以个人开发者、小型技术团队为主,常用于数据新闻、商业仪表盘、科研演示、教学工具等场景。由于是开源项目,globe.gl 没有官方客服或技术支持,但社区活跃度不错,GitHub 上有 Issue 和讨论区可参考。
globe.gl 最适合以下几类用户:第一,前端开发者,尤其是熟悉 JavaScript 和 Three.js 基础的人,可以快速集成并自定义地球样式。第二,数据新闻团队或内容创作者,需要在地球上标注事件地点、航线、人口分布等,且希望以 3D 形式呈现。第三,科研或教育机构,用于展示地理空间数据,例如气候变化影响、物种分布等。第四,小型创业公司,预算有限但需要快速搭建地理数据看板,globe.gl 零成本、无版权风险。不适合的场景包括:需要高精度地形、卫星影像、室内地图或大规模实时数据流(如千万级标记点),这些场景建议考虑 Cesium 或 Mapbox。
globe.gl 是开源项目,完全免费,无任何付费套餐或订阅费用。这意味着它的价格档位属于“零成本”,对于预算敏感的个人或团队极具吸引力。但需要注意,免费不代表无隐性成本:部署时需要自行准备 Web 服务器或 CDN,数据源(如地球高清纹理、卫星图)可能需要额外获取或付费购买商用版权。此外,如果项目需要专业的技术支持或定制开发,社区无法提供 SLA 保障,这部分人力成本需自行承担。总体而言,globe.gl 的性价比极高,尤其适合技术能力较强的团队。
globe.gl 作为纯前端 JavaScript 库,网络通畅性极佳:它不依赖海外服务器,代码可托管在国内 CDN(如七牛、阿里云 OSS)或直接打包进项目。中国用户无需任何科学上网工具即可正常使用。支付方面,由于是开源项目,无需付费,不存在支付问题。发票方面,globe.gl 本身不开具发票(无商业主体),但若通过第三方平台(如 npm、GitHub)下载,这些平台也不提供发票。如果需要发票,可考虑使用国内替代品(如 ECharts 的 3D 地球扩展)或通过外包公司集成 globe.gl 并开具服务费发票。国内同类替代品包括:ECharts 的 globe 组件(百度开源,中文文档完善)、Cesium 中文社区版(功能更重)、以及基于 Three.js 的自研方案。
优点:
缺点:
globe.gl 最适合需要快速搭建 3D 地球数据可视化原型、且预算为零的开发者或小团队。如果你的项目仅需展示少量标记点、弧线或热力图,且对地形精度无要求,那么直接使用 globe.gl 是最高效的选择。建议先克隆官方 GitHub 仓库,运行示例代码,确认功能满足需求后再集成。不适合的场景包括:需要商业技术支持、需要发票报销、需要高精度地理数据(如地形、卫星影像)、或需要处理百万级实时数据。在这些情况下,建议考虑 Cesium 或 Mapbox 的付费方案,或使用国内 ECharts 配合后端优化。总之,globe.gl 是开源世界的优质工具,但请合理评估自身技术能力和项目需求。
⚠ 本测评基于公开资料整理, 不构成购买建议. 请以 globe.gl 官网实际信息为准.
globe.gl 是一家 开源 的 开发工具 (Data Visualization) 服务商. TG4G 测评收录其 套餐「3D地球数据可视化组件」, 综合评分 8.0/10, 中国可用度 友好. 点击「前往官网」可直达 globe.gl 官方页面.